Yep, it's another Mirage Resorts product, and Steve Wynn really outdid himself with the Bellagio. Just by looking at the place you notice something different about it. Forget about the neon, this place is all about elegance with an Italian flavor.

-----

So what does the Bellagio offer besides the casino area?

1. Botanical Conservatory: An area filled with plants and flowers for that natural aromatherapy.

2. Gallery of Fine Art: No where else in Las Vegas is there a more extensive collection of fine art for public viewing. Steve Wynn wanted the best pieces of art that he could get his hands on such as Monet, Matisse, Van Gogh, Picasso, and etc. It costs $6 if you're a NV resident or $12 for non-residents, and it's open from about 8am to 11pm.

3. Cirque Du Soleil's "O": Well, I haven't seen this show yet, but my relatives and friends who have.....are very impressed with this aquatic marvel!

4. Spa Bellagio/Salon at Bellagio: A great place to be pampered, massaged, and etc.

5. Fountains at Bellagio: Yep, the lake in front of the Bellagio isn't there just to fill up some space. There is a fountain show usually in the afternoon to late at night at regular intervals with about 1000 fountains that perform a sort of water-ballet that is highlighted with color, light, and music. The best part of this one is that it's FREE Ninety-FREE.

6. The Shops of Via Bellagio: If you've got some deep pockets, then this is the place for you to shop. Giorgio Armani, Gucci, Chanel, Hermes, Tiffany & Co., and others are all here.

7. Top-notch Dining: The Bellagio offers quite a few top-notch restaurants such as Le Cirque, Olives, Shintaro, Prime, Picasso (with Picasso's works of art displayed of course), Circo, and etc. In addition, don't forget about their Buffet. It's less than $30, and take note: KING CRAB LEGS! Can you ever get enough King Crab Legs? I know that I can't!

PLEASE NOTE:

- The Bellagio has a "No one under 18 years of age" policy with the exception being registered guests and some other cases. Check out their website (shown below) for more details.

- Promotional Pricing: See, it pays to use the Internet. Go to their website to see their dates for promotional pricing on staying at the Bellagio.

- There are two main self-parking areas for the Bellagio. One is off of the entrance from Las Vegas Blvd which is the main garage parking. The second is off of Flamingo Road a little to the west of Las Vegas Blvd, and this parking area is very limited.....usually only for those people who go to see the Cirque du Soleil show, O.
